diff options
| -rw-r--r-- | drivers/hid/wacom_wac.c | 6 | 
1 files changed, 3 insertions, 3 deletions
| diff --git a/drivers/hid/wacom_wac.c b/drivers/hid/wacom_wac.c index 104829524bcd..63821c0e8207 100644 --- a/drivers/hid/wacom_wac.c +++ b/drivers/hid/wacom_wac.c @@ -2405,7 +2405,7 @@ int wacom_setup_pad_input_capabilities(struct input_dev *input_dev,  	case INTUOSPS:  		/* touch interface does not have the pad device */  		if (features->device_type != BTN_TOOL_PEN) -			return 1; +			return -ENODEV;  		for (i = 0; i < 7; i++)  			__set_bit(BTN_0 + i, input_dev->keybit); @@ -2450,7 +2450,7 @@ int wacom_setup_pad_input_capabilities(struct input_dev *input_dev,  	case BAMBOO_PT:  		/* pad device is on the touch interface */  		if (features->device_type != BTN_TOOL_FINGER) -			return 1; +			return -ENODEV;  		__clear_bit(ABS_MISC, input_dev->absbit); @@ -2463,7 +2463,7 @@ int wacom_setup_pad_input_capabilities(struct input_dev *input_dev,  	default:  		/* no pad supported */ -		return 1; +		return -ENODEV;  	}  	return 0;  } | 
